Understanding Male Breast Reduction

Male breast reduction, also known as enlarged male breast surgery, is a cosmetic procedure designed to remove excess fat and glandular tissue from the chest. This surgery falls under the broader category of male body contouring and is tailored to restore a natural chest appearance.

Common Causes of Gynecomastia

  • Hormonal imbalances

  • Genetic predisposition

  • Weight gain or obesity

  • Certain medications (steroids, antidepressants)

  • Aging

By addressing these underlying causes, chest fat removal during surgery can be more effective and long-lasting.

Step 1: Preparing for Male Breast Reduction

Before undergoing chest contouring surgery, preparation is key to ensuring safe and successful results.

Medical Consultation

During your initial consultation, a board-certified surgeon will:

  • Assess the size and composition of your chest (fat vs glandular tissue)

  • Review your medical history and medications

  • Discuss your aesthetic goals

This stage ensures that gynecomastia treatment is customized to your needs.

Pre-Surgery Guidelines

  • Stop smoking at least 2–4 weeks before surgery

  • Avoid blood-thinning medications (aspirin, NSAIDs)

  • Maintain a stable weight for optimal results

  • Arrange for transportation and post-operative care

Tip: Proper preparation reduces risks and improves healing after enlarged male breast surgery.


Step 2: What Happens During Male Breast Reduction

Male breast reduction typically takes 1–3 hours depending on the complexity of the case. There are two primary techniques:

1. Liposuction for Chest Fat Removal

This technique is ideal for patients with excess fatty tissue but minimal glandular growth.

  • Small incisions are made near the chest

  • A cannula removes excess fat

  • Incisions are closed with sutures, leaving minimal scarring

2. Excision for Glandular Tissue Removal

For men with significant glandular tissue or sagging skin:

  • A surgical incision is made around the areola

  • Excess tissue and skin are removed

  • The chest is reshaped for a natural contour

Some patients may require a combination of liposuction and excision, providing optimal results in chest contouring surgery.

Anesthesia

  • General anesthesia or local anesthesia with sedation is used

  • The choice depends on the surgical technique and patient comfort

Recovery considerations begin immediately, and proper post-operative care is crucial for both aesthetic outcomes and safety.


Step 3: Recovery and Aftercare

After male breast reduction, following your surgeon’s instructions is essential for a smooth recovery.

Immediate Post-Surgery

  • Compression garments are worn for 4–6 weeks to reduce swelling

  • Mild pain or discomfort is common and managed with prescribed medications

  • Drains may be temporarily placed to prevent fluid accumulation

First Two Weeks

  • Avoid strenuous activity and heavy lifting

  • Maintain good hygiene around the incision sites

  • Attend follow-up appointments to monitor healing

Long-Term Recovery

  • Swelling typically resolves within 4–6 weeks

  • Final chest shape becomes evident after 3–6 months

  • Healthy lifestyle habits help maintain results from male body contouring

Note: Results of chest fat removal and enlarged male breast surgery are long-lasting if weight is stable.

Potential Risks and Complications

While gynecomastia treatment is generally safe, patients should be aware of possible complications:

  • Infection or bleeding

  • Asymmetry between sides of the chest

  • Temporary numbness or reduced sensation

  • Minor scarring at incision sites
